What is a Bank Account Certificate?
A bank account certificate, also known as a bank account statement or proof of account, is a document issued by a bank that confirms the existence and status of a bank account. It typically includes the account holder’s name, account number, account type, balance, and transaction history. Lenders require this certificate to evaluate the applicant’s financial situation and determine their ability to repay the loan.

Types of Bank Account Certificates
There are several types of bank account certificates that may be required for a loan application:
| Certificate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Bank Account Statement | A detailed statement of account transactions over a specified period |
| Account Verification Letter | A letter from the bank confirming the account holder’s identity and account details |
| Proof of Account Ownership | A document showing the account holder’s name and account number |
How to Obtain a Bank Account Certificate for Loan Application
Obtaining a bank account certificate for loan application is a relatively straightforward process:
- Contact your bank’s customer service or visit a branch
- Request a bank account certificate or statement
- Provide identification and account information
- Specify the required document type and period
- Receive the certificate or statement
Some banks may offer online banking services that allow you to download account statements or certificates directly from their website.
